Luxury is not simply the sort of life accorded by only a heap of money. Rather it is a fashion of living, with elements of pleasure and comfort added to it, and may not require as much money as you think. If you’ve set your mind to living luxuriously, you’ll need to commit to hard work and find a constant source of earning first.

Luxury Spot

Designate an area within your home for your luxury experiences. It can be any corner of the house that you visit often, for instance, your bedroom or kitchen. Find all the sorts of things that would make that area worth staying, you can google this stuff and buy according to your budget.

Luxury Trip

Take a break from routine and go on a trip. Visit different luxury resorts and exotic locations, preferably within Europe. Try a vacation on Lapland, where you can witness the northern lights and hence literally have a once in a life experience.

Eat Good

Designate one night of every week for restaurants, take your picks from local options, and dine with luxury. Spend money on good quality food, ready-to-make items, and exquisite beverages. But remember not to overdo anything.

Give Yourself Nice Treats

Spend more money for fewer treats. This way, you can buy good quality treats for yourself, such as fine chocolates or exotic foods such as caviar (but remember not to buy the caviar of endangered species as that is immoral). Make your treats count and make the best out of them.

The idea behind luxury is comfort. There is no set amount of money you have you have to spend for this purpose. Whatever makes your life comfortable is luxury, just remember never to overdo stuff. Don’t pour out more money than you make because once caught in a financial crisis, it is hard to enjoy life at all. That being said, enjoy life, you deserve it
